Ive got a RCA Lyra and it hasnt failed me once. It's not as flashy as an iPod, but it gets the job done.

Pluses include..

-No special software needs.
- Plays any type of music format; no need to change into *.(anything)
-Accessible HD for storage, in addition to music. Great for transferring movies/school work/anything from one computer to another.
-Cheaper than an iPod.
-Not an iPod.

Minuses include..

-No search feature (but who needs one if you know what you're looking for?)
- 2 Color display
- Boring looking..



.. but the newer ones are full color I believe, and cheaper than when I bought this.



In closing- More than you need, none of the flash; cheap, but user friendly and comes with unexpected benefits.
